Winnie-Madikizela Mandela was buried on Saturday in a grand ceremony in South Africa. There were prominent people in attendance and they talked about Winnie's impact in the fight for independence in the nation. However, things took a turn when Julius Malema, leader of the Economic Freedom Fighters (EFF) and former African National Congress Youth League (ANC-YL) President. His speech attacked those he viewed as 'hypocrites' who had hurt Mama Winnie (as he called her) in her lifetime but attended the funeral and were 'mourning' with the others.
It was a fiery speech that then trickled down to social media. Twitter was ablaze over the weekend with the #JuliusMalemaChallenge. People called out funny situations in their life that were as a result of disingenuous people who pretended to care but actually didn't. The memes did it for me.
